
A study that assessed the efficiency of polypectomy techniques for diminutive adenomas reveals differences in resection rates. Researchers found that the cold snare polypectomy (CSP) method yielded a significantly lower incomplete resection rate than cold forceps polypectomy (CFP). The study underscores CSP's superiority in resecting small lesions and suggests a target S-IRR (segmental insufficient resection rate) of <5% for optimal results. This research highlights the importance of precise resection methods in reducing the metachronous adenoma burden.
